I work for a major internet service provider, for the last 8 years we've been stuck in an epic legal battle with both the FBI and most Hollywood production companies. Why? Because they want us to monitor every byte of data which comes through our servers and then alert them to any illegal activity (namely pirating). Not only that but they want us store each and every byte of data on our servers so they can access it for legal purposes without a warrant, an operation which would cost us tens of millions of dollars. And no they aren't willing to foot the bill.

The last time we were taken to court the Supreme Court ruled that it was against Australia's privacy policies to force something like this from a company, let alone monitor its own clients. They are taking us to court again now after we walked out of negotiations because they weren't giving 'reasonable' demands.

So do you think that the FBI and Hollywood has the right to dictate what a privately run company in a completely different country operates? Also do you think its reasonable for them to demand that all Australian citizens are monitored online?
